Building Inspector Salary in Wilmington, Delaware

The median building inspector salary in Wilmington, DE is $66,885 per year, which is 5.0% above the national median and 4.0% above the Delaware state average.

Building Inspector Salary in Wilmington by Experience

In Wilmington, an entry-level building inspector earns around $44,100, while experienced professionals earn up to $99,750 per year. The local cost of living index is 105% of the national average.

Job Outlook

Nationally, building inspector employment is projected to grow 3% over the next decade (as fast as average). Demand in Wilmington may vary based on local industry and population growth.
